Dear all,

I would like to know if somebody has already used or has experience with a piece of software called "TransPDF" (http://www.iceni.com/transpdf.htm). It is supposed to convert .pdf files to .xliff files and to convert back translated .xliff files to .pdf files "of the highest quality" (as stated on the company's website).

In any case, the website itself suggests to use also another piece of softwer called "Infix" for the cleanup of translated .pdf files, which may suggest that in any case the conversion does not keep all the formatting associated to the native file.

I am also wondering if somebody has experience with other pieces of softwares which promise to convert .pdf files to other formats (i.e. doc) - I think it must be a rather common topic of discussion, since everybody has had issues concerning .pdf files.

Nitro Pro May 16, 2017

I'm currently using Nitro Pro 10 and it can convert most decent PDFs to Word format. By "decent" I mean ones which are easily modifiable and do not contain scanned or hidden elements that might hamper the translation process and the final outcome.
